VanBlog:真的太丝滑啦,简洁实用优雅的个人博客系统,支持文章、评论、分类、标签一站式管理,赶紧上车

简介: 嗨,大家好,我是小华同学。VanBlog是一个基于Vue3、Vite、NaiveUI和TypeScript的开源博客系统,支持Markdown编辑,具备文章发布、评论、分类、标签、搜索等功能。界面简洁美观,响应式设计适用于各种设备。

嗨,大家好,我是小华同学,关注我们获得“最新、最全、最优质”开源项目和高效工作学习方法

image.png

VanBlog是一个基于Vue3、Vite、NaiveUI和TypeScript的开源博客系统。它支持Markdown编辑,具有丰富的功能,如文章发布、评论、分类、标签、搜索等。VanBlog界面简洁美观,响应式设计,适用于各种设备,让你随时随地都能愉快地写作和阅读。

项目效果

image.png
image.png
image.png
image.png
image.png

核心功能

1. 文章发布与管理

VanBlog支持Markdown编辑,让你在撰写文章时更加便捷。你可以轻松创建、编辑、发布文章,并对文章进行分类和标签管理。此外,VanBlog还支持文章搜索,让你快速找到所需内容。

2. 评论功能

VanBlog内置了评论功能,允许读者在文章下方留言。你可以对评论进行管理,包括审核、回复、删除等操作。

3. 响应式设计

VanBlog采用响应式设计,无论是电脑、平板还是手机,都能获得良好的阅读体验。

4. 丰富的扩展功能

VanBlog支持多种扩展功能,如统计文章阅读量、文章推荐、友情链接等,让你更好地展示个人品牌。

应用场景

1. 个人博客

使用VanBlog,你可以轻松搭建属于自己的个人博客,记录生活点滴、分享技术心得。

2. 知识库

VanBlog可作为个人知识库,帮助你整理和归纳所学知识,提高学习和工作效率。

3. 团队协作

VanBlog也适用于团队协作,团队成员可以共同撰写、编辑和分享文章,促进知识交流。

具体使用方法

1. 安装

首先,你需要克隆VanBlog的代码到本地:

git clone https://github.com/Mereithhh/vanblog.git

然后,进入项目目录,安装依赖:

cd vanblog
npm install

最后,运行项目:

npm run dev

2. 配置

在项目根目录下,找到.env.development文件,修改以下配置:

VITE_APP_TITLE=你的博客标题
VITE_APP_DESCRIPTION=你的博客描述
VITE_APP_KEYWORDS=你的博客关键词,用逗号分隔

3. 写作与发布

登录后台管理,点击“新建文章”,开始撰写你的第一篇文章。编辑完成后,点击“发布”即可。

应用场景

Vanblog适用于多种场景,无论是个人技术博客、生活分享、还是企业内部知识管理,Vanblog都能满足需求。以下是一些具体的应用场景:

1. 个人技术博客

对于技术爱好者来说,Vanblog是一个理想的平台,可以记录自己的学习心得、项目经验,同时与他人分享和交流。

2. 生活分享

Vanblog也适合用来记录和分享生活中的点滴,如旅行日记、美食推荐等,让更多人了解你的生活故事。

3. 企业知识库

企业可以使用Vanblog搭建内部知识库,分享工作经验、技术文档等,促进团队之间的知识共享和协作。

同类项目对比

1. Hexo

Hexo是一款流行的静态博客生成器,支持Markdown编辑。与VanBlog相比,Hexo的搭建过程较为复杂,需要安装Node.js、Git等环境。而VanBlog则采用Vue3、Vite等技术,搭建过程更简单。

2. WordPress

WordPress是全球最流行的开源博客系统,功能丰富,插件众多。但相较于VanBlog,WordPress的界面较为复杂,且在国内访问速度较慢。

总结

VanBlog是一款简洁、易用、功能丰富的开源博客系统。无论是个人博客、知识库还是团队协作,VanBlog都能满足你的需求。快来尝试一下吧,相信你会爱上这款博客系统!

项目地址

https://github.com/Mereithhh/vanblog
相关文章
|
Kubernetes Java Nacos
nacos常见问题之通过helm方式部署设置开启授权认证功能如何解决
Nacos是阿里云开源的服务发现和配置管理平台,用于构建动态微服务应用架构;本汇总针对Nacos在实际应用中用户常遇到的问题进行了归纳和解答,旨在帮助开发者和运维人员高效解决使用Nacos时的各类疑难杂症。
1011 0
ToC和ToB有啥区别
ToC(Consumer)面向普通用户服务,ToB(business)是面向企业用户服务。对公司的营销体系和商业模式而言,定位客户群体,决定产品设计、运营管理、市场营销等系列操作。 1.1 业务形态不同
11961 2
|
监控 网络安全 索引
Elasticsearch-通过Kibana查看索引数据
引言   当数据存储到Elasticsearch后,我们希望能方便的通过界面进行查询,有两个工具能够满足我们的需要,一个是Elasticsearch-head插件,另一个是Kibana,笔者认为两个工具各有千秋,大家可以自行体会,不过就安装步骤来说,Elasticsearch-head真心麻烦,本文主要介绍如何部署Kibana,并使用Kibana来查看Elasticsearch中的索引数据。
10708 1
|
11月前
|
运维 监控 Cloud Native
深入理解云原生技术:从概念到实践
在数字化转型的浪潮中,云原生技术如同星辰指引航船,引领企业驶向灵活、高效的未来。本文将深入浅出地探讨云原生的核心理念、关键技术及应用实例,旨在为读者揭开云原生的神秘面纱,展示其如何重塑软件开发与运维模式。通过理论与实践的结合,我们将一窥云原生技术的强大动力和无限可能。
|
机器学习/深度学习 存储 算法
【一文了解物联网卡】
【一文了解物联网卡】
1624 3
|
9月前
|
弹性计算 关系型数据库 数据库
从自建到云端,数据库迁移全攻略
本文详细介绍了将自建数据库迁移至阿里云RDS的全过程,涵盖WordPress网站安装、数据库迁移配置及验证等步骤。通过DTS数据传输服务,实现库表结构、全量和增量数据的无缝迁移,确保业务连续性和数据一致性。方案具备零成本维护、高可用性(最高99.99%)、性能优化及全面的数据安全保障等核心优势。此外,提供了详细的图文教程,帮助用户快速上手并完成迁移操作,确保业务稳定运行。点击文末“阅读原文”了解更多详情及参与活动赢取精美礼品。
453 13
|
Oracle 关系型数据库 数据库
[windows]远程桌面失败提示CredSSP加密修正
[windows]远程桌面失败提示CredSSP加密修正
2299 6
【Vscode+Latex】Mac 系统Vscode的LaTeX中插入参考文献
在Mac系统下的VSCode环境中配置LaTeX工作流以便插入和引用参考文献的详细步骤。
808 0
|
存储 人工智能 运维
SLS 大模型可观测&安全推理审计标准解决方案
本文介绍大模型可观测&安全推理审计解决方案和Demo演示,SLS 提供全面的 LLM 监控和日志记录功能。监控大模型使用情况和性能,自定义仪表盘;SLS 汇总 Actiontrail 事件、云产品可观测日志、LLM 网关明细日志、详细对话明细日志、Prompt Trace 和推理实时调用明细等数据,建设完整统一的大模型可观测方案,为用户的大模型安全推理审计提供全面合规支持。
105492 1

热门文章

最新文章